This week the topic is “Underrated/Hidden Gems You’ve Read in the Past Year”. This is my first time participating in this meme here on my blog. I always see a lot of postings on other blogs and thought that I would give it a try this week. I don’t know if I can get to 1o but we’ll see!
- The German Girl by Armando Lucas Correa – this came out last year and is his debut novel, it was so moving and emotional!
- The Shell Collector by Anthony Doerr – everyone has read his book All The Things We Cannot See. I think people should read this little collection of short stories that he’s written.
- Burial Rites by Hannah Kent – a book set in Iceland and historical fiction!!
- Night Film by Marisha Pessel – an amazing mystery/thriller!
Wow! I could only come up with 4 books that I’ve read in the past two years that I deem underrated/hidden gems. I need to start straying away from popular opinion books and search for the unknown!
